    Exclamation Riskee/Ruyan #4 health hazard

    I made about this same post 10 months ago asking the question "is Riskee risky?", and now I am stating it rather than asking.

    For me, Riskee/Ruyan #4 causes infected taste buds if vaped for more than 2 days in a row.

    An infected taste bud is when just one taste bud swells, turns red/white, and causes great pain on your tongue. My mother used to call them "lie bumps". You also might be familiar with then from eating too much acidic citrus-based fruits like lemons or pineapples.

    I have done my own little study with this juice and I have gotten the same results for 6 months straight after I made the connection. This has not occurred with any of the other juices I use.

    After 2 days of just Riskee/Ruyan #4, I will get at least one infected taste bud. If I do not switch juices, the infection continues and spreads to other taste buds. When I do switch to another juice, the infection begins to heal and go away.

    Riskee/Ruyan #4 is my favorite flavor juice and even though the infection is painful, I will not give it up. I just use it in moderation.

    If this has happened to you, please share. It could be that I am allergic to an ingredient and thus not a concern for most of the vaping population.
